KING'S SWIMMERS SPLIT WITH ARCADIA, MESSIAH

Full Box Score

 

WILKES-BARRE –  The King's College women's and men's swim teams split results Saturday in a tri-match against visiting Messiah College and Arcadia University.  The women defeated Arcadia 88-33 but fell to Messiah 76-45. The men, meanwhile, fell to Messiah 82-32 while also dropping a 77-34 verdict to Arcadia.

 

In the women's 200 freestyle, Maggie Nealer touched first at 2:06.53. She also captured the 500 freestyle with a time of 5:41.15. In the 200 individual medley, Nealer finished third with a 2:32.87.

In the women's 1,000-freestyle, Becca Smith placed first with a time of 11:57.02.  In the women's 100-freestyle, Smith was second at 100.74 while also placing second in the 500 freestyle with a 5:55.10.

 

In the women's 100-backstroke, Amanda Casey finished second with a time of 1:09.30. In the women's 100 butterfly, Caitlyn Casey placed second at 1:11.56

 

In the women's 100-breaststroke, Patricia Manning won the event with a 1:14.46  She also captured the 200-breast stroke with a time of 2:36.83. In the 200 individual medley, Manning was second at 2:21.32.

 

The women's 200 medley relay team of Amanda Casey, Caitlin Casey, Krystna Homanko, and Stephanie Hughes were second with a time of 2:10.40

 

In the women's 400-freestyle relay, King's team of Smith, Manning, Nealer, and Caitlin Casey were second with a time of 4:05.28.

 

In the men's events, Eric Stencovage won the 50-freestyle with a time of 24:02. He was also second in the 100-breaststroke at 1:04.69 as well as In the 200-breaststroke with a time of 2:28.26.

 

In the 200-butterfly, Justin Weilert placed second at 2:22.91. The 100 freestyle event saw, Jack Harrington place second with a time of 55:29. In the 500-freestyle, Joshua DeBellas  placed second with a time of 6:03.10.
